Data Port Case/Inlet Only - 316 SS Cover with One Blank Plug & One Open Port
SmartPlug data ports are the perfect complement to SmartPlug's stainless shore power inlets. It offers the same look and quality as marine-grade stainless steel components. This particular data port case has one blank plug and one open port.
*All single data port inlets are supplied with one connector and one blank insert.
Features:
Blank and open port
Weatherproof Seal, which seals against a closed-cell foam gasket in the inlet lid
Locks into the edge of the SmartPlug mounting flange
